This morning when I saw the CAS challenge was to use plaids, I was happy, as I had this sheet of plaid sitting on my desk that I just made, using alcohol inks. So off to cut the butterflies and make my own scored plaid bg.
Now I'm here to upload, and I see that the TLC is to use dimension. Well if these butterflies aren't dimensional, I don't know what is.
So a big yippee from me, that this card fits both of today's challenges!
I used the MS scoreboard to make my own plaid bg, and Adirondack alcohol inks to make the plaid. I love playing with messy stuff! The butterflies are from SU!'s Sizzix die and Spellbinders dies.
